Boozy Boy by Superfumista is a Woody Spicy fragrance for women and men. This is a new fragrance. Boozy Boy was launched in 2022. The nose behind this fragrance is Benjamin Sachs. Top notes are Rum, Cognac, Cinnamon, Cloves and Black Pepper; middle notes are Cacao, Oak and Plum; base notes are Amber, Woodsy Notes, Ambergris, Tonka Bean and Orris Root.

Benjamin Sachs
Benjamin Sachs is a perfumer known for his work with the Superfumista brand, where he created a diverse range of fragrances including Boozy Boy, Dolce Nissa, Infra Rose, Lemon Delight, Minty Mint, Nu Blanc, Our Blurry Note, and Poivre Rubis. His compositions often explore contrasting themes, blending gourmand, floral, and fresh elements. Sachs' approach balances creativity with precision, resulting in scents that are both distinctive and wearable.
